How do you cite a book in the Canadian Journal of Earth Sciences referencing style? (2024 Guide)
One of the most cited mediums is of course books. Here’s how to cite a book in Canadian Journal of Earth SciencesHere’s an example book citation in Canadian Journal of Earth Sciences using placeholders:
Last Name, F.N. 2000. Title. In Edition. Edited byE.F.N. Editor Last Name. Publisher, City.
Canadian Journal of Earth Sciences citation:
Angelou, M. 1969. I Know Why the Caged Bird Sings. In 1st edition. Random House, New York.

How to reference a journal article in the Canadian Journal of Earth Sciences citation style?
How do you cite scientific papers in Canadian Journal of Earth Sciences format?
An Canadian Journal of Earth Sciences citation for a journal article includes the author name(s), publication year, article title, journal name, volume and issue number, page range of the article, and a DOI (if available). Here’s howHere’s a Canadian Journal of Earth Sciences journal citation example using placeholders:
Author1 LastnameA.F., and Author3 LastnameA.F. 2000. Title. Container, Volume: pages Used. Journal Name. doi:DOI.
Petit, C., and Sieffermann, J. 2007. Testing consumer preferences for iced-coffee: Does the drinking environment have any influence?. 18: 161-172. Food Quality and Preference. doi:10.1016/j.foodqual.2006.05.008.

How to cite a website in a paper in Canadian Journal of Earth Sciences style?
Have you found a credible website you want to cite in Canadian Journal of Earth Sciences to include in your research paper or presentation? Here’s howHere’s an Canadian Journal of Earth Sciences example website reference:
Author1 LastnameA.F., and Author2 LastnameA.F. 2000, January 1. Title. Publisher. Available from https://www.example.com [accessed 25April2024].
https://www.theguardian.com/world/2008/nov/05/uselections20083
on The Guardian website:
Tran, M. 2008, November 5. Barack Obama To Be America’s First Black President. The Guardian. Available from https://www.theguardian.com/world/2008/nov/05/uselections20083 [accessed 25April2024].
